Can GeForce RTX 5080 run Anomaly Road?
GreatThe GeForce RTX 5080 handles Anomaly Road well at 1080p, delivering approximately 571 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 429 FPS.
Anomaly Road – GeForce RTX 5080 FPS Data
| Quality | 1080p | 1440p | 4K |
|---|---|---|---|
| Low | 893 fps | 670 fps | 357 fps |
| Medium | 714 fps | 536 fps | 286 fps |
| High | 571 fps | 429 fps | 229 fps |
| Ultra | 464 fps | 348 fps | 186 fps |
Estimated FPS · actual performance may vary based on drivers and settings

To run Anomaly Road effectively, an entry-level GPU such as the GTX 1650 or RX 6500 XT is recommended. This ensures a smooth experience at 1080p resolution with medium settings, which should provide a good balance between visual quality and performance. The game is not particularly demanding, making it accessible for a wide range of hardware, especially for those with mid-tier systems.
For users with more powerful GPUs, like the GTX 1660 Super or RX 6600, targeting higher settings at 1080p or even 1440p is feasible. These setups can take advantage of better frame rates and enhanced graphical fidelity, enhancing the overall immersion in the game’s atmospheric environment. On the other hand, older or less powerful systems can still run the game but may need to lower settings to maintain acceptable performance.
